Hello Dolphin Forums, I'm having some problems getting my games to run at 100% speed or even close to that. I have a 2010 Macbook Pro 15 inch OS x 10.8. With an i7-620m @ 2.66 and 3.33 Turbo boost. Also I have an Nvidia GeForce 330m with video memory 512mb and 8gb of DDR3 ram. I'm running Dolphin 3.5-367.
Settings I have enabled: Dual Core (speedup), Idle Skipping (speedup), DSP HLE emulation, Native resolution, Open GL (obviously), No AA, AF 1X, EFB copies; Texture and Ram with enabled Cache, disable fog, and OpenMP texture decoder.

To date i've tired to play, Metroid Prime, Metroid Prime Corruption and Metroid other M. They all run, and look decent.. but the performance is just terrible. On average the speed is about 76% ~ 15 - 24Fps. (in small hallways the performance is good, but in open areas, it lags) I don't know if i'm missing something, but i've searched and read everything I could and my hardware seems good enough. Metroid series are all demanding games . Most demanding games require Quad Core i5 3570k 3.4 -> 4.5GHz
Your i7 is just a dual core CPU , not mention it's 1st gen Intel Core I series . The i5 3570k is 3rd gen
Quote:With an i7-620m @ 2.66 and 3.33 Turbo boost
3.33GHz is just single core turbo
3.0GHz (2 cores) is the real turbo clock speed
http://www.cpu-world.com/CPUs/Core_i7/In...981AH.html
So your i7 performance should be identical to my i5 in Dolphin

Some good games I've played
_New Super Mario Bros (with "EFB copies to texture" - for performance , "EFB...Ram" - for accuracy is out of the question)
_Muramasa the demon Blade (full speed all the time)
_Xenoblade - is a demanding game (require a specific Dolphin version for playing near full speed , latest Dolphin is out of the question)
_Mario Kart : won't run full speed , you will get more speed with Direct3D11 back end ( most games run faster with Direct3D9 , except this game and some others) . 50FPS (60FPS is full speed) with Dolphin 3.5- 145 , latest Dolphin run slower ...
_The Last Story will be playable at 18-20 FPS (30FPS is full speed) if you use Vbeam speed hack (Right-click the game - Properties) . To run TLS near full speed or full speed all the time , you need i5 3570k @ 4.5GHz or even higher
